WebThe executive branch carries out and enforces laws. It includes the president, vice president, the Cabinet, 15 executive departments, independent agencies, and other boards, commissions, and committees. Judicial. The judicial branch interprets the meaning of laws, applies laws to individual cases, and decides if laws violate the Constitution.
